Introducing Elexis Jones, Chelsea Jones, Liam Jones and Violet Jones.

The tiny quadruplets were born just after 1 a.m Thursday to proud mom Jenn Jones, 26, and dad Logan Jones, 27.

"I'm still in shock. Seeing them after they came out, I thought, 'how were all four of you guys all inside me? You're so big,' " the new mom said Thursday.

The new dad was beside himself. "I spent an hour just looking at each of them. They were grabbing my finger," he said.

The infants -- born at 29.5 weeks gestation -- are on ventilators, being cared for by the nurses and doctors of the neonatal intensive care unit.
